Student account

Q: I need more storage space on my student account.

A: We do not increase individual student quota for courses. The reason is simple. We may not subsequently go in and clean up stored data that is not removed voluntarily. The space available is calculated to be sufficient for all courses. You may use up to 1GB of storage but we will send a reminder to anyone with over 180MB to clean up in order to keep total amount of data down on the file server. If the course coordinator sees a need for additional space then it is possible to create project areas. There we can clean up after the course has finished since it is counted as a temporary space. So bring the issue to the course coordinator.

Matlab

Q: Matlab does not work for me but for everyone else in the lab room.

A: A file classpath.txt in your root directory can sometimes cause problems. Try to rename it. If problems was solved you can remove it.
